I just created a website so people could find out about my buisness if they heard the name. I am not in the phone book yet and I thought if i started a website people would be able to search my business name and find it. The problem is I can't even find my website using the search method I have to already know what the wbsite address is and type it in. I did a search on my business name and flipped through the first 20 pages and still no sign of it. Is there anything i can do to make it easier to find?

I'm sorry you're having trouble getting your site to show up in search engine results.

I'm not sure which search engine you may be using, but since Google is the most popular, I did a quick check to see if your site has been indexed by Google. You can do this by typing site:yourdomain.com in Google search (replace yourdomain.com with your actual domain name). I found that currently two of your site's pages are indexed by Google.

Search engine optimization can be a challenge and can depend on such things as location (for inclusion in local search results) and competitiveness of your keywords (how many other people are trying to rank for the same keywords).

I would also suggest setting up a Google Webmaster Tools account for your site so you can analyze your site's traffic and even share information with Google about your site.
